Harsh Vardhan Goenka is an Indian industrialist and businessman and the chairman of RPG Enterprises (popularly known as RPG Group) since 1988. Harsh Goenka is the eldest son of R. P. Goenka, the founder and chairman Emeritus of the RPG Group. He is one of India’s prominent industrialists with an experience of more than 35 years.

Wiki/Biography

Harsh Goenka was born on Tuesday, 10 December 1957 (age 66 years; as of 2023) in Kolkata, India. His zodiac sign is Sagittarius. He pursued a bachelor’s degree in Economics at St. Xavier’s College, Calcutta. He pursued an MBA at the International Institute for Management Development, Lausanne, Switzerland. Since his graduation at IMD, he has been on the Board of IMD, Lausanne. Growing up in Calcutta (now Kolkata), Goenka was deeply influenced by Marxism. Harsh wanted to become a Journalist or ‘red’ economist, but his family wanted him to join the family business. According to Harsh, they “brainwashed him” into choosing a capitalist path, removing his leftist approach and making him lead the family business as its fifth generation.

Family

Harsh Goenka belongs to the Marwadi community of money-lenders, and tradesmen in Rajasthan.

Parents & Siblings

Harsh Goenka’s, father, Rama Prasad Goenka, was an Indian businessman, and his mother, Sushila Goenka, was a businesswoman. Rama Prasad Goenka was the founder and chairman Emeritus of the RPG Group, and Sushila was a director of Saregama India Ltd. Harsh has a younger brother, Sanjiv Goenka, who is an Indian industrialist and the chairman of the RP-Sanjiv Goenka Group. Harsh’s father passed away on 14 April 2013 and his mother passed away in July 2018. [1]The Telegraph

Career

After completing his formal education, Harsh returned to Bombay from Switzerland and was appointed as the managing director of the CEAT in 1983 at the age of 24. He played a major role in many joint ventures and partnerships of the RPG group, the family-owned business of the Goenka clan, with the Fortune 500 companies in India, including Vodafone, Fujitsu, Phelps Dodge, Yokohama, and Rolls-Royce. In 1990, Harsh succeeded his father, Dr. R. P. Goenka, as the chairman of the RPG Group.

In 2010, R. P. Goenka divided the RPG group among his sons, Harsh Vardhan Goenka, and Sanjiv Goenka. At the time, the RPG group had a market capital of Rs 9,150 crore and sales of Rs 13,313 crore. After the division, Harsh got the company’s power supply business KEC International, the software firm Zensar Technologies, the drug manufacturing unit RPG Life Science, and the tyre production firm CEAT. Spencer International Hotels Ltd was the only company that remained under the joint ownership of Sanjiv and Harsh Goenka.

Goenka’s RPG ventures back startups, such as seniority.in, an e-commerce site for senior citizens. He is the former president of the Indian Merchants’ Chamber, an Indian organisation representing interests of Indian trade, commerce, and industry, and a member of the executive committee of the Federation of Indian Chambers of Commerce & Industry, a non-governmental trade association and advocacy group based in India. He is a former Member of the Board of Governors of the National Institute of Industrial Engineering (NITIE). He is the director of Bajaj Electricals Ltd and a Trustee of Breach Candy Hospital Trust.

Controversy

Harsh Goenka VS Twitter

In March 2023, Harsh Goenka, who remains very active on Twitter, shared a meme on his account, which was a series of distasteful cartoons that made fun of the women battling fluctuating weight. This meme created an uproar among the Twitterati, claiming Harsh Goenka to be a misogynist and a fatphobic. The cartoon depicted a saree-clad woman in 1995 ready to grind spices in a stone mortar. The second featured a dress-wearing woman looking at a mixer grinder. The main difference was that of the sizes and weights. Many of his followers retweeted it with captions pointing him out for his fat shaming. As a result, Goenka deleted the tweet. [2]Moneycontrol

  • Harsh Goenka is a contemporary art enthusiast and has hosted multiple art exhibitions in Bombay. He has a huge collection of artworks at CEAT Mahal, RPG’s headquarters in Mumbai, which is nothing less than an art gallery. He owns the works of many famous artists like M F. Hussain, Laxman Shrestha, Atul Dodiya, and Bikash Bhattacharjee. [5]Business Standard
